I worked as a Middle School Librarian Assitant (No more certified Librarian) and serve a population of 1048 studentsand 68 teachers. I have aManga And Graphic Novels Club and an Anime Club running in the Library. I also run the homework Club (either morning or afternoon).

Mansfield University Scholarship Program – Begin in January 2012

In an ongoing effort to recruit a new generation of school library leaders, Mansfield University recently received a fifth Institute of Library and Museum Services (IMLS) grant to fund scholarships for its totally online School Library & Information Technologies Master of Education degree program with school library certification. If you know of an educator or non-certified librarian seeking school library certification, please pass along the news that we are still accepting applications for the spring 2012 semester.

The Master of Education program, ideally suited for working educators
with no time to drive to a university, offers a convenient and effective path to school library certification.
